Edward Henry Potthast (1857-1927)
Little Sea Bather
signed 'E Potthast' (lower left)
oil on board
12¼ x 16 in. (31.1 x 40.6 cm.)
Provenance
The artist.
Estate of the above.
E.H. Potthast II, nephew of the artist.
Louise Potthast Schumacher, grandniece of the artist.
The Merrill J. Gross Collection, Cincinnati, Ohio, acquired from the above.
Grand Central Art Galleries, New York.
Sotheby's, New York, 29 May 1986, lot 207.
Acquired by the present owner from the above.
Literature
Corcoran Gallery of Art, Edward Henry Potthast, N.A., 1857-1927, exhibition catalogue, Washington, D.C., 1973, n.p., no. 3.
Exhibited
Cincinnati, Ohio, Cincinnati Art Museum, 1965, no. 3 (as Timidity).
Youngstown, Ohio, Butler Institute of American Art, 1965, no. 3.
Cincinnati, Ohio, Taft Museum, 1968, no. 9.
Washington, D.C., Corcoran Gallery of Art, The Merrill J. Gross Collection: Edward H. Potthast, N.A., 1857-1927, March 16-April 22, 1973, no. 3.
